Gary Dockery, like a 20th-century Rip Van Winkle, slept in a coma for 71/2 years. He was a police officer who had been shot in the head while on duty. Unconscious and unable to communicate, he was dead to the world.
Then a medical miracle occurred. He awoke! He immediately recognized his family and told his two sons he loved them. For 18 hours he talked, recalling the past and learning what had happened during his long sleep. After emergency surgery to drain fluid from his lungs, however, Dockery never regained the same level of consciousness. He died a year later.
